What should I do the second I discover a major water leak in my home?

Your first action is to stop the water source. Know the location of your main water shut-off valve. If you are near Suzanne Park, note that rapid utility isolation is the critical first step in 'loss of use' mitigation. Immediately call your utility provider for emergency shut-off if the interior valve fails. This single action limits damage and forms the basis of a defensible insurance timeline.

How urgent is water damage mitigation for mold growth?

The microbial amplification window is 48-72 hours from the initial intrusion. Mitigation protocols, including controlled demolition and establishing drying goals, must begin within this window to meet the 2026 Standard of Care. Delays beyond this period shift liability and typically require full Category 2 remediation protocols, as the water degrades to a contaminant hazard.

You say my Snow Creek home is still wet even though the floor feels dry. How is that possible?

Surface moisture is only part of the equation. The 2026 IICRC S500 standard requires drying to a psychrometric equilibrium of 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) of dry air at 70°F. 'Dry to the touch' often masks high vapor pressure within materials. We use thermo-hygrometers to measure GPP in the air cavity, ensuring the structure itself—not just the surface—meets the dry standard for Walnut's climate.
